From 2882b7626f4903a8e9250b328cdf7396a6deecac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Anders Roxell Date: Thu, 10 Dec 2020 13:44:22 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] sh: kernel: traps: remove unused variable When building defconfig the following warning shows up: arch/sh/kernel/traps.c: In function 'nmi_trap_handler': arch/sh/kernel/traps.c:183:15: warning: unused variable 'cpu' [-Wunused-variable] unsigned int cpu = smp_processor_id(); ^~~ Remove an unused variable 'cpu'.
